Output a7866bc203861012c817e00df5a8157a9347910ba38e771b2f86ec0bc8f81b94:5

value
2473673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5374fd367aef54bdf6db9abd3c4fec2f84ce557b OP_EQUAL
address
39JJA1dgiAB3MFgqNMD2CF5KpPSTGa4oVT
transaction
a7866bc203861012c817e00df5a8157a9347910ba38e771b2f86ec0bc8f81b94
confirmations
463685
spent
true